With developments in modern technology, the shift in the direction of high-density interconnect (HDI) PCBs has actually acquired traction, permitting smaller sized, a lot more powerful gadgets that can efficiently take care of increasing information loads. HDI boards include finer pads and traces, shorter links, and greater connection density, making them invaluable for applications in mobile phones, tablets, and other portable electronics. On the other hand, flexible printed circuits (FPCs) have actually become a game-changer, supplying bendable solutions that comply with different shapes and dimensions. This adaptability helps with the design of small and light-weight electronic devices that can quickly be incorporated into items like wearables.

The manufacturing of flexible PCBs calls for different techniques compared to common rigid boards, consisting of specialized products that can endure repeated flexing without losing connection. Making use of polyimide and various other flexible substratums is critical in ensuring sturdiness and durability. As understanding of PCB manufacturing expands, important considerations should likewise consist of the numerous facets of design, such as fiducials and microvias. Fiducial marks enhance the accuracy of component placement during assembly, while microvias permit more detailed links in HDI boards, enabling tighter spacing between traces. Buried and blind vias can further increase circuit density, providing chances for sophisticated circuit designs that push the limits of conventional PCB designs.

In situations where power supply stability is essential, heavy copper PCBs have obtained acknowledgment as a durable option. These boards include thicker copper layers to manage high current lots, making them excellent for applications in power electronics, such as power supply boards and commercial circuits. The application of metal core products, such as aluminum or ceramic substratums, in specific PCB designs additionally help in thermal management, ensuring that warmth is dissipated successfully, therefore extending component life and enhancing integrity.
